About St Helens
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
St Helens is home of the academic institute St Helens College. The biggest sports facility in St Helens is Totally Wicked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Whiston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Taylor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the World of Glass Museum, which showcases St Helens’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it St Helens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Liverpool John Lennon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around St Helens with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are St Helens Bus Station and St Helens Central railway station.
In St Helens,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ash, Contactless card and Mobile payment.
About Norwich
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 70%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%.
Norwich is home of the academic institute University of East Anglia. The biggest sports facility in Norwich is Carrow Road,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Norfolk and Norwich University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Eaton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Norwich Castle Museum and Art Gallery, which showcases Norwich’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Norfolk and Norwich Millennium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Norwich International Airport by Taxi and Bus.
There are several ways to get around Norwich with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Norwich Bus Station and Norwich Railway Station.
In Norwich,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ash, Contactless card and Mobile payment.
